What companies run services between Helsinki Airport (HEL), Finland and Kannus, Keski-Pohjanmaa, Finland?

Finnair flies from Helsinki Airport (HEL) to Kokkola-Pietarsaari Airport (KOK) twice daily. Alternatively, Finnish Railways (VR) operates a train from Tikkurila to Kannus 5 times a day. Tickets cost €60–110 and the journey takes 3h 56m.
